cancel
Showing results for 
Search instead for 
Did you mean: 

Community Engineering Newsletter, May 13 – 17, 2019

lkrell
New Contributor

Get a quick update on all Community Engineering projects including completed and in-progress stories, features, and testing. Welcome new contributors joining your community projects. Check open requests and good first issues in the project boards.

 

If you missed a meeting or demo, want to join a specific project and contribute, or have questions, check the links to recordings, project boards, and more.

 

Connect with Community Engineering

Community Portal | Google Calendar (iCal) | Slack

slack-logo.png Join us on Slack!

To connect with Magento and the Community, join us on the Magento Community Engineering Slack. Want to join, send a request at engcom@adobe.com or self signup. For a list of channels, see this list.

 

imagine2019-top.png

 

Imagine 2019!

#magentoimagine | #imagine2019

What an incredible week of sharing knowledge and experiences! This newsletter includes updates for the week in Community Engineering and Imagine. These are just a few of the highlights from the numerous events!

 

You, the Magento Community, have contributed far more than code. You have provided expertise, progressive ideas, solutions to problems, and much more. The numbers though are amazing!imagine-prs.png

 

 

Contribution Day – We held a 2-day contribution event including Magento core, GraphQL, MSI, PWA, DevDocs, Adobe Stock Integration, and much more! We received a great number of contributions, held many discussions, welcomed new contributors, and learned from our veterans.

 

The event included a Beginner’s table with a new Beginner’s Guide on the M2 wiki. The wiki info and David Manners helped the group get started FAST! We had many new contributors join us. Thank you!

imagine-contrib1.png

 

imagine-contrib2.png

 

imagine-contrib3.png

 

imagine-contrib4.png

 

imagine-contrib5.png

 

imaginecontrib2.png

 

 

Livestreams & Recordings – If you missed watching the livestreams, see this page to watch those recordings. Additional recordings will be posted for the sessions. Keep watching Imagine 2019 for details.

 

Magento Masters – Congratulations and thanks to all of our Magento Masters, heart and soul in the community! They were welcomed to the stage in their super hero capes! See more about our masters in these blogs: Mentors, Movers, Makers.imagine-masters.png

 

 

Excellence Awards – Magento also awarded merchants, partners, and more. The finalists were announced in this blog post. Winners were announced and awarded on the big stage during Imagine! Many in our community aided these sites with designs, code, and more. Congratulations to all!imagine-excel.png

 

 

DevExchange – The Community, Magento, and Adobe came together to discuss many topics at the DevExchange, the ending event of Imagine. The groups covered diverse topics from work environments, testing, features, remote, events, and much more!imagine-devex.png

 

 

Magezine – Strix Commerce brought a printed magazine devoted solely to Magento on Magento Imagine - MAGEzine. Sign up here to get your copy: https://www.magezine.co/

Issue 1 includes:

  • Service Isolated Architecture in Magento
  • Success story of Magento MSI for TOUS
  • Docker for Magento
  • PWA Studio
  • Migration from M1 to M2
  • and much more!imagine-magezine.png

     

 

MSI

GitHub | Project Board | Slack |DevDocs | User Guide

Magento Coordinator: Igor Minialilo, Eugene Shakhsuvarov

Meetings:

Meeting recordings:

 

GraphQL

GitHub | Project Board | Backlog | Slack | DevDocs

Magento Coordinator:  Valeriy Nayda, Nishant Kepoor

Meetings:

 

PWA Studio

Project Board | GitHub | Slack | DevDocs

Magento Coordinator: James Zetlen, Andrew Wilcox

    • Venia: Toasts and notifications

Meetings:

Meeting recordings:

 

Asynchronous Import & Bulk API Project

Project Board | GitHub | Slack | DevDocs Bulk API & Async API

Community Project Maintainer: Alex Lyzun from comwrap

Magento Coordinator:  Volodymyr Kublytskiy

Meeting:

Meeting recording:

 

Adobe Stock Integration

GitHub | Wiki | Slack

 

Localization and Translations

Japanese GitHub  | Slack Japanese 

GitHub | Project Board | Slack TranslationsMagento CrowdIn

Magento Coordinator: Volodymyr KublytskiyPiotr Kaminski

Meeting:

 

Cloud ece-tools

GitHub | Improvements | Slack | DevDocs

 

MFTF Conversion

GitHub | Project Board | Slack

Magento Coordinator: Alex Kolesnyk

 

Magento 2

Community Backlog | GitHub| Slack

 

Magento Architecture

GitHub | Project Board | Architecture Slack | Services Isolation Slack

Magento Coordinator: Olga Kopylova

Architecture:

  • [Proposed] Batch query services, #163
  • [Proposed] Simplified module declaration (More details and clarification), #162
  • [Proposed] Contract for JSON encoding/decoding, #161
  • [Merged] Proposed removal of some static checks for phtml template files, #160
  • [Merged] Distributed deployment tools, #129
  • [Merged] Simplified module declaration, #63

Services Isolation:

Meetings:

Meeting recordings:

 

Magento Coding Standards

GitHub | Project | Slack | Project

Magento Coordinator: Lena Orobei

  • [Opened] Results showing duplicate inspections, #98
  • [Opened] Delete ConstantUsageSniff (Magento2.Translation.ConstantUsage) from coding, #97
  • [Opened] Empty FUCNTION statement detected should be allowed for around plugins, #95
  • [Merged] Magetwo-99387: Prohibt usage of native htmlspecialchars(), #96

Meeting: